Three business partners incorporated a private limited company to process agricultural produce. One year after operations commenced, one partner decided to sell her equity stake to an outside investor without obtaining consent from the remaining members. Which regulation or characteristic of a private limited company prevents this transfer from occurring freely?

The statutory restriction on share transfer contained in the Articles of Association
Private limited companies are legally required to restrict the right to transfer shares in order to preserve their private character. The specific internal rules and restrictions governing share transfers are documented within the Articles of Association.
